I'm a bit meh on the XTX. I expected a definitive 10-15% lead but instead, it's a low single digits advantage over the 4080. For the same power consumption, they'll probably be about the same. Their performance per price is also the same if we're talking about RT on average. So it boils down to someone being willing or not to spend $200 more for an extra 16-26% RT performance.

While there are bugs to be fixed on the voltage curve that might improve power consumption, I doubt that will allow for much higher clocks without a refresh. The saving grace here is the chiplet design allowing the Navi 31 chip to be cheaper to manufacture than AD103, so at least RTG can compete in a price war.
